The President of the Republic, Sergio Mattarella, opened yesterday in Venice the fourth edition of the Festival L'Italia delle Regioni, scheduled until May 20. Promoted by the Conference of Regions and Autonomous Provinces, in collaboration with the Veneto Region, the Festival is dedicated this year to the theme "Discovering regional excellence: a journey between innovation and tradition". In his speech, Mattarella reiterated that "autonomy entails the recognition of certain competencies to be exercised within the limits established by the constitutional dictate and protected from encroachment by others". The Head of State stressed that a constant relationship between the different levels of government is indispensable to manage the intertwining of competencies, especially between the State and the Regions, while respecting the principle of loyal cooperation, repeatedly recalled by the Constitutional Court. An emblematic example is the health sector, where "the competition of State and Regions is essential to guarantee the right to health of citizens". Mattarella spoke of the need for unified strategies to bridge imbalances between regional health care systems, improve efficiency and ensure universal and uniform coverage throughout the country. Finally, the President called for enhancing Italian excellence with full awareness of strengths but also weaknesses to be addressed with "courageous reforms". Among the priorities, he pointed to digitization, justice, energy, sustainability and public works, recalling that all these areas are at the center of the interventions included in the National Recovery and Resilience Plan.
